Weak references are not implemented in the version of perl
Usually, this has to do with the XS component of Scalar::Util not being found (in which case weaken() is not available):
$ perl -MScalar::Util=weaken -e'weaken(\my $var)' $ sudo mv /usr/lib/perl5/5.8.8/x86_64-linux-thread-multi/auto/List/Uti +l/Util.so /usr/lib/perl5/5.8.8/x86_64-linux-thread-multi/auto/List/Ut +il/Util.so_hide $ perl -MScalar::Util=weaken -e'weaken(\my $var)' Weak references are not implemented in the version of perl at -e line +0 BEGIN failed--compilation aborted.
